David "Silly Billy" Kaye - June, 2017

Image

David Kaye has performed magic and comedy for children for more than twenty years. Known to the public as "Silly Billy," he has become one of the best known children's entertainers in the U.S.

David has performed at the White House, Lincoln Center, on The Late Show with David Letterman, as well as for the families of celebrities like Madonna and Bruce Springsteen. He has consulted for companies like Children's Television Workshop, McDonald's (for the Ronald McDonald program), and even M.I.T. regarding how to entertain children.

In 2014, David received the prestigious Performing Fellowship Award from the Academy of Magical Arts (The Magic Castle). Other magicians who have received this award include Juan Tamariz, Johnny Thompson, and Penn and Teller. David is the only children's magician in history to receive this award.

David has appeared on the covers of seven international magic magazines including Genii, MAGIC, and M-U-M; he wrote a monthly column in MAGIC magazine for eight years and starred on the magic TV show Celebracadabra. David is currently a columnist for Genii magazine. He travels the world performing magic for children and speaking at magic conventions.

But he may be best known for his groundbreaking book, Seriously Silly: How to Perform Magic and Comedy for Children, considered by many to be the bible for children’s magic. His new book, Super Sized Silly, has just recently been published through Kaufman and Company, and offers over 150 routines from David and a roster of some of the most successful, in-demand magicians in the field of children’s entertainment today.

As a guy who will never do a kid show, and who is interested primarily in coin and card magic, let me say that David's last lecture in the Seattle area (which I attended mostly to see what all the fuss was about), is one of the best magic lectures I've seen in the 35 years I've been attending them. I aspire to be as thoughtful about what I do, as he is about his work.

If you haven't seen him lecture, and he's in your area, you damn well should. The fuss is well founded.
